AquaController - Страница 2 - Аквафорум - форум аквариумистов и террариумистов


На сайт Всеукраинской Ассоциации аквариумистов
На главную страницу форума



 


Вернуться   Аквафорум - форум аквариумистов и террариумистов > Аквариум и оборудование > "Самоделкин" > Аквариумная автоматика
Аукцион Регистрация Дневники Справка Пользователи Календарь Поиск Сообщения за день Все разделы прочитаны

Важная информация

Ответ
 
Опции темы Опции просмотра
Старый 06.01.2017, 11:47  
AquaController
 
Аватар для AquaGomel
Живу я тут

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
 

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
AquaGomel AquaGomel поза форумом 06.01.2017, 11:47
Рейтинг: (1 голосов - 5.00 средняя оценка)

Уважаемые аквариумисты, хочется поделиться информацией и опытом по созданию умной "железяки" аквариумного контроллера. За последние несколько лет развитие одно платных компьютеров и им подобных шагнуло далеко в перед. Если ранее нужно было сидеть с паяльником травить лудить и вообще обладать не дюжими знаниями в области радиоэлектроники и программирования, то на текущий момент все это упростилось на столько что появилась возможность и желание сделать все самому. А посему, сею тему буду развивать и поддерживать в силу свободного времени и развития проекта...

Контроллер выполнен в виде нескольких функционально законченных блоков. Данный контроллер построен на платформе Arduino Nano на микроконтроллере ATmega328. Основной упор при разработке делался на дешевизну проекта, поэтому использовались простые комплектующие без сенсорных экранов и прочих излишеств. За исходный функционал брался контроллер Юсупова, а так же меню и экраны управления были взяты по примеру этого контроллера. За исключением собственного функционала.

Комплектующие:

Скрытый текст

Основные функции.
Скрытый текст

Текущее состояние проекта:
Скрытый текст

Пишется мобильный клиент.
Скрытый текст

Также пишется документация по работе с устройством его сборке и прошивке... Полная документация

Что из этого можно будет потрогать руками?
Практически все. Все материалы по плате, схема, разводки, gerber файлы я выложу после исправления ошибок.

Распиновка
Скрытый текст

Для чего это?
Да на форуме много тем с различными проектами аквариумной автоматики, данное устройство не претендует на какую-то оригинальность, делалось под себя, и возможно кому-то понравится данный проект... На все вопросы с удовольствием отвечу, все советы с удовольствием выслушаю...

Вложения
Тип файла: zip AquaControllerProtocoll.zip (151.7 Кб, 67 просмотров)
Тип файла: zip Schema_v1_1.zip (42.4 Кб, 54 просмотров)
Тип файла: zip Elemets_list.zip (7.4 Кб, 34 просмотров)
Тип файла: zip Schema_power_v1_1.zip (29.7 Кб, 35 просмотров)
Тип файла: zip Power_gerber_v_1_1.zip (88.6 Кб, 20 просмотров)
Тип файла: zip Power_PCB_v_1_1.zip (89.5 Кб, 21 просмотров)
Тип файла: zip Elemets_list_power.zip.zip (7.5 Кб, 31 просмотров)
Тип файла: zip AquaController_1v1_30630.zip (31.5 Кб, 31 просмотров)
Тип файла: zip PCB_gerber_v_1_3.zip (215.0 Кб, 12 просмотров)
Тип файла: zip PCB_v_1_3.zip (1.17 Мб, 10 просмотров)


Последний раз редактировалось AquaGomel; 29.05.2017 в 13:16..
Просмотров: 9163
Ответить с цитированием
20 пользователей поблагодарили AquaGomel за данный пост:
AlexVOK (02.05.2017), Alserk-3 (28.05.2017), AndrewUh (05.04.2017), Arduino (07.01.2017), Asrok (11.01.2017), chack (28.03.2017), imac2008 (18.01.2017), kolljj (06.01.2017), mashenkaM (28.03.2017), myprog (06.01.2017), nickanya (06.01.2017), orthos (23.01.2017), Sem (06.01.2017), Torin21 (24.03.2017), Vadim_VD (04.05.2017), xxxFeLiXxxx (18.04.2017), ya7sergey (28.03.2017), yarishNEW (18.01.2017), Сергій М (06.01.2017), Юрий77 (06.01.2017)
Реклама помогает развиваться
Старый 11.01.2017, 02:49   #16
Я тут недавно
  
 
Регистрация: 12.05.2015
Адрес: Киев
Сообщений: 67
Поблагодарил(а) : 25
Поблагодарили 18 раз(а) в 10 сообщениях
Re: AquaController ===www.aquaforum.ua===

Отличный бюджетный контроллер да еще и с мобильным клиентом ))))

Сократ поза форумом   Ответить с цитированием
Старый 11.01.2017, 08:35   #17
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Цитата:
Сообщение от Сократ Посмотреть сообщение
Отличный бюджетный контроллер да еще и с мобильным клиентом ))))
Спасибо, сейчас как раз таки клиент и доделываю...

AquaGomel поза форумом   Ответить с цитированием
Старый 13.01.2017, 09:04   #18
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Добавил схему и файлы печатной платы, чуть позже Gerber закину...

AquaGomel поза форумом   Ответить с цитированием
Пользователь, который поблагодарил AquaGomel за данный пост:
Sem (13.01.2017)
Старый 13.01.2017, 09:31   #19
Живу я тут
  
 
Аватар для Sem
 
Регистрация: 17.09.2004
Адрес: Киев, Троещина
Сообщений: 14,148
Поблагодарил(а) : 4,339
Поблагодарили 7,913 раз(а) в 4,213 сообщениях
Записей в дневнике: 7
Отправить сообщение для Sem с помощью ICQ Отправить сообщение для Sem с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

*dsn будет?
__________________
Страна ублюдков и воров.


__________________

Sem поза форумом   Ответить с цитированием
Старый 13.01.2017, 09:36   #20
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Цитата:
Сообщение от Sem Посмотреть сообщение
*dsn будет?
Я не волшебник я только учусь, так что расшифруйте пожалуйста, что должно быть? Gerber в шапке.

AquaGomel поза форумом   Ответить с цитированием
Реклама помогает развиваться
Старый 13.01.2017, 09:56   #21
Живу я тут
  
 
Аватар для Sem
 
Регистрация: 17.09.2004
Адрес: Киев, Троещина
Сообщений: 14,148
Поблагодарил(а) : 4,339
Поблагодарили 7,913 раз(а) в 4,213 сообщениях
Записей в дневнике: 7
Отправить сообщение для Sem с помощью ICQ Отправить сообщение для Sem с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Файл протеуса. Или не пользуетесь для отладки?
__________________
Страна ублюдков и воров.


__________________

Sem поза форумом   Ответить с цитированием
Старый 13.01.2017, 09:59   #22
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Цитата:
Сообщение от Sem Посмотреть сообщение
Файл протеуса. Или не пользуетесь для отладки?
Нет не пользуюсь, я сразу купил 3 ардуинки, осталась одна, как спалю последнюю начну пользоваться))) Или еще 3 куплю...

AquaGomel поза форумом   Ответить с цитированием
Пользователь, который поблагодарил AquaGomel за данный пост:
Sem (13.01.2017)
Старый 18.01.2017, 15:56   #23
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Пока жду последнюю комплектуху, накидал модельку платы, ценности особой в разработке не имеет, ну если только прикинуть как крепить и.т.п. А покрутить прикольно...
Миниатюры
3D_PCB.pdf  

AquaGomel поза форумом   Ответить с цитированием
Старый 18.01.2017, 17:02   #24
Бан за нарушения
  
 
Регистрация: 27.11.2016
Адрес: Arduino
Сообщений: 99
Поблагодарил(а) : 12
Поблагодарили 20 раз(а) в 15 сообщениях
Re: AquaController ===www.aquaforum.ua===

AquaGomel, вы не думали что разъём Х2 будет мешать подключению через мини-юсб?
Я у себя вобще сделал в корпусе отверстие и не разбирая подключаю его к юсб.

Arduino поза форумом   Ответить с цитированием
Старый 18.01.2017, 19:31   #25
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Цитата:
Сообщение от Arduino Посмотреть сообщение
AquaGomel, вы не думали что разъём Х2 будет мешать подключению через мини-юсб?
Я у себя вобще сделал в корпусе отверстие и не разбирая подключаю его к юсб.
USB у меня используется только в момент прошивки, причем прошиваются мозги без установки в плату. Все питание только внешнее 5v700mA блоки, ну и ESP8266 через ams1117 3.3V, И если уж встанет такая необходимость воткнуть шнурок, для снятия лога или еще для чего, то под разъемом все контакты неиспользуемые, поэтому все подключается свободно. А вообще в планах было сделать на mini без всяких USB, но пока будет на nano, так сказать сначала обкатать нужно на более простом девайсе, а потом займемся минимизацией и удешевлением

AquaGomel поза форумом   Ответить с цитированием
Пользователь, который поблагодарил AquaGomel за данный пост:
imac2008 (18.01.2017)
Старый 18.01.2017, 22:33   #26
Бан за нарушения
  
 
Регистрация: 27.11.2016
Адрес: Arduino
Сообщений: 99
Поблагодарил(а) : 12
Поблагодарили 20 раз(а) в 15 сообщениях
Re: AquaController ===www.aquaforum.ua===

AquaGomel, я свою постоянно перепрошиваю, потому что нет пределу совершенству

Arduino поза форумом   Ответить с цитированием
Старый 02.02.2017, 12:32   #27
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Блин как же долго идет из Китая комплектуха! Пока набросал документацию по протоколу передачи данных между клиентом и устройством. Буду пока жду дальше документацию оформлять.
Миниатюры
AquaControllerProtocoll.pdf  

AquaGomel поза форумом   Ответить с цитированием
Старый 16.02.2017, 18:33   #28
Живу я тут
  
 
Аватар для AquaGomel
 
Регистрация: 31.07.2010
Адрес: Белоруссия, Гомель
Сообщений: 169
Поблагодарил(а) : 20
Поблагодарили 84 раз(а) в 32 сообщениях
Отправить сообщение для AquaGomel с помощью ICQ Отправить сообщение для AquaGomel с помощью Skype™
Re: AquaController ===www.aquaforum.ua===

Собственно сегодня закончил со сборкой, а так же пробно упаковал все в корпус. Получилось не очень. Сразу вылезло пару косяков. Когда заказывал корпус, расстраивался что он не весь железный, как же я радуюсь теперь что резать пришлось пластик а не металл. В домашних условиях вырезать ровно просто не реально, а по сему, следующий корпус закажу лазерную резку. Бо в ручную получилось "топорно". Но как для себя то сойдет. Второе, когда делал расстановку деталей не учел что нужно крепить внутренние детали силовой части, управления и.т.п. Поэтому пришлось приклеивать... В общем 80% времени занимает работа с корпусом. Получилось вот так:
Силовой блок:

Сам контроллер:

В сборе:

Вот как-то так. Сейчас будет тест всех режимов работы на небольшой банке. Затем придется немного повозиться еще с прошивкой модуля связи. Ну а потом выложу для всех желающих материалы для повторения, еже-ли будут такие...
Миниатюры
Нажмите на изображение для увеличения
Название: DSC_0050.JPG
Просмотров: 128
Размер:	136.1 Кб
ID:	582908   Нажмите на изображение для увеличения
Название: DSC_0052.JPG
Просмотров: 130
Размер:	77.9 Кб
ID:	582909   Нажмите на изображение для увеличения
Название: DSC_0053.JPG
Просмотров: 76
Размер:	161.7 Кб
ID:	582910   Нажмите на изображение для увеличения
Название: DSC_0054.JPG
Просмотров: 140
Размер:	147.6 Кб
ID:	582911   Нажмите на изображение для увеличения
Название: DSC_0055.JPG
Просмотров: 26
Размер:	98.9 Кб
ID:	582912  

Нажмите на изображение для увеличения
Название: DSC_0056.JPG
Просмотров: 69
Размер:	138.1 Кб
ID:	582913   Нажмите на изображение для увеличения
Название: DSC_0057.JPG
Просмотров: 132
Размер:	130.6 Кб
ID:	582914  

AquaGomel поза форумом   Ответить с цитированием
4 пользователей поблагодарили AquaGomel за данный пост:
Arduino (17.02.2017), gabam (16.02.2017), imac2008 (17.02.2017), Sem (16.02.2017)
Старый 17.02.2017, 12:20   #29
Бан за нарушения
  
 
Регистрация: 27.11.2016
Адрес: Arduino
Сообщений: 99
Поблагодарил(а) : 12
Поблагодарили 20 раз(а) в 15 сообщениях
Re: AquaController ===www.aquaforum.ua===

AquaGomel, смотрится весьма серьёзно
Больше похоже на сложную технику СССР, чем на простой акваконтроллер
желания перейти на твердотельные реле не появилось? Меня немного напрягает когда клацает реле? И для обогревателя дополнительные залипающие контакты не очень, сам наступил на эти грабли и уже получил твердотельные...

Arduino поза форумом   Ответить с цитированием
Старый 17.02.2017, 14:27   #30
Я тут недавно
  
 
Аватар для Pro100LED
 
Регистрация: 18.03.2016
Адрес: Киев
Сообщений: 43
Поблагодарил(а) : 9
Поблагодарили 31 раз(а) в 19 сообщениях
Re: AquaController ===www.aquaforum.ua===

AquaGomel, добротно вышло. Вы говорили про стоимость такого аппарата в районе 15$ без корпуса, куда нести деньги?

Pro100LED поза форумом   Ответить с цитированием
Пользователь, который поблагодарил Pro100LED за данный пост:
Дмитрий79 (15.03.2017)


Share/Bookmark

Ответ

Метки
aquacontroller, arduino, esp8266


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 
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ход







Текущее время: 21:45. Часовой пояс GMT +3.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d. Перевод: zCarot
(с)Бешлега Александр Анатольевич, 2002-2015. Использование материалов сайта без ссылки на источник запрещено.
Благодарим за лицензионную версию форума компанию Барбус, представителя торговой марки Sera в Украине.

Друзья форума: www.akvariumi.com.ua/; Интернет-магазин аквариумных товаров "У Водяного" http://eshop.aqua.in.ua/; Интернет-магазин http://ezoo.com.ua/

AQA.ru  - все об аквариумах

no new posts